Every year, lots of boats return from the cruising life with a boat full of gear they no longer need. Where do they go to sell that gear? Where can you find the best selection and best deals on used outboards, liferafts, safety gear, spare anchors, etc? Below are some options. Can anyone suggest more?

In addition, lots of sailing group websites, such as Lats & Atts, sailboatowners dot com, etc., have classifieds sections worth checking out for bargains, or using to post your own items for sale.
